Product Overview & Official Specifications

The JuviPerpric 2‑in‑1 combines a traditional contact tachometer probe set with a Class II laser sensor, letting you choose the method that best fits the job without swapping devices. The unit feels like a chunky remote control – 5.29 oz, 4.72 × 2.36 × 1.18 in – and slides comfortably into a standard tool belt pouch.

Real-World Performance & In-Depth Feature Analysis

Build Quality & Material Performance

The ABS housing feels solid enough for daily shop use, but it’s not ruggedized for extreme drops. In a 3‑ft accidental fall onto concrete, the front panel cracked a hairline line – still functional, but the screen’s backlight dimmed slightly. The laser sensor’s housing is a small sapphire‑glass window that resisted scratches during a month‑long test on dusty fan blades.

Daily Operation & Performance

Switching between modes is a single button press; the device immediately shows a ‘Laser On’ icon. In non‑contact mode, I measured a 14‑k RPM HVAC fan from a distance of 30 cm with a 5‑% ambient light increase, and the reading stayed within ±0.6 % of a calibrated reference meter. Contact mode using the 3 mm probe on a 7 mm shaft produced a reading within ±1 RPM of a bench‑top tachometer.

Setup Experience & Compatibility

Unboxing was straightforward: the battery compartment, a quick‑start guide, and the four probes fit neatly in the supplied foam tray. The only friction point was the lack of a dedicated “reset to factory” button – you must hold the mode key for 10 seconds, which isn’t clearly illustrated in the manual. Compatibility is wide‑ranged; the laser works on reflective metal, painted surfaces, and even glossy plastics, though matte black finishes reduced signal strength by ~15 %.

Long-Term Durability & Reliability

After 150 hours of mixed use (non‑contact checks on fans, contact checks on pumps), the unit showed no drift in accuracy. Battery life remained consistent; the low‑battery warning triggered at 12 % capacity, exactly as advertised. The auto‑off function, while handy for conserving power, occasionally cut off during a long‑duration test; disabling it via the menu solved the issue.

Frequently Asked Questions

Can the laser sensor measure RPM on painted metal?
Yes, but highly matte paints can reduce reflectivity, causing a ~15 % drop in signal strength. A quick tap with a reflective sticker restores accuracy.
What battery type is recommended?
A standard AA alkaline works fine; for longer life you can use a high‑capacity NiMH (up to 2 years of intermittent use).
How do I switch between contact and non‑contact modes?
Press the Mode button; the LCD toggles an icon indicating the active mode.
Is the device calibrated out of the box?
Factory calibration is pre‑set to ±0.05%FS+1 RPM (laser) and ±0.1%FS+1 RPM (contact). No user calibration required for typical use.
Can I use the tachometer on a conveyor belt?
Yes, the laser can capture speed from a moving belt surface; just ensure the belt has a reflective patch.
What is the warranty period?
One‑year limited warranty covering manufacturing defects.
Does the unit store measurement history?
No built‑in memory; you’ll need to write down readings or use an external logger.
Is it safe to use around eye‑hazardous lasers?
The laser is Class II (≤1 mW), safe for casual viewing, but avoid direct eye exposure for prolonged periods.
